Social Fetch
Social Fetch is a social media scraping API covering major platforms including TikTok, Instagram, YouTube, X, LinkedIn, Facebook, and Reddit, with access to profiles, posts, comments, and transcripts.
Basecamp
Basecamp provides specialized capabilities in project management & tasks, delivering intuitive features, flexible integration options, and team reliability.
